Michael Laudrup was approached for the managerial job by the Football association of Denmark, but, he refused to accept the offer.

A statement released by the association read, “We tried to get Michael on board, but, it did not materialize. He is not willing to take up the job right now because of private reasons.”

Laudrup is the 5th most capped player for Denmark till date.

He was an absolute superstar in the soccer world in the eighties and the nineties.

The 51-year old, who was a playmaker, made more than 100 appearances for the Red and White.

Laudrup has pursued a career in management and has had the opportunity to manage clubs in different countries, but, he has not had as much of success in that field as he had as a player.

He is currently jobless after parting ways with Lekhwiya a few months ago.

According to some of the reports, the main reason why Laudrup has opted to deny the offer of Denmark association is that he feels because of his image of a genius in the eyes of the Football fans in the country, the hopes will be immensely high with him if he takes charge and he will be under pressure right away.”

Denmark did not have a successful European qualification campaign. They could only secure 12 points out of 8 group games and finished at no. 3 in their group.

They had to go into the playoffs thereafter where they were beaten by Sweden and got knocked out.

Taking the responsibility of the failure, Morten Olsen, who had been in charge of Denmark for a long, long time, resigned from the post of the manager and ever since, there had been discussions that Laudrup would succeed him in the job, but, as it has turned out, it’s not going to be the case.
